Pull Request Overview

This PR cleans up the code by refactoring existing logic and refining import statements.

  • In MarkdownText.kt, the onTextLayout assignment has been refactored to use the let expression for cleaner, more concise code.
  • In MarkdownCode.kt, wildcard imports have been replaced with explicit named imports for better clarity and maintainability.
